Mehndi Of Sania Mirza



The Mehndi ceremony of the newly-wed Indian tennis star Sania Mirza, who tied the knot with Pakistani cricketer Shoaib Malik earlier in the week, was today held at a city hotel here.
Both Sania and Shoaib, who got married on Monday, attended the ceremony.
Sania's outfit for the occasion was designed by Shantanu and Nikhil, while Shoaib's dress was gifted to his newly-wed wife's family members, the tennis player's spokesperson said.
The guests had a lively evening as some enthralling music was played out on the occasion.



The menu for the evening included a lavish spread of about seven starters, a salad counter, a kebab corner, 10 main course dishes and six deserts, the spokesperson added.
Former tennis players Jaideep Mukherjee and Akhtar Ali also attended the wedding celebrations.
Clad in a pink salwar kameez , Sania Mirza shows off her mehendi. The tennis ace recently walked hand-in-hand with Shoaib Malik for the first time after they tied the knot.
Sania's father Imran Mirza embraced his son-in-law and other members of the family welcomed the newly-wed couple into the residence.
The high-profile wedding took place three days ahead of the original schedule to silence the controversy and drama surrounding their marriage.
The mehendi ceremony, which was to be observed ahead of the wedding, was observed on April 13 at the Mirza residence and Marfa band was organised as part of the celebrations.
Sandhya and Bhavana, Hyderabad's reputed mehendi designers, were called to apply mehendi to Sania, her spokesperson told reporters.
